Lufthansa Check in Baggage Rules
Understanding Lufthansa check-in baggage rules helps ensure a smooth airport experience. From baggage size and weight limits to policies on extra items, here’s a complete guide to what you can bring and how to check it in.
Lufthansa check in Baggage Size Limits
Lufthansa sets clear guidelines for check-in baggage size based on your travel class:
- Economy Class: 1 bag (max 23 kg) with dimensions 158 cm (Length + Width + Height).
- Premium Economy Class: 2 bags each with a maximum weight of 23 kg and size up to 158 cm.
- Business Class: 2 bags, each up to 32 kg, maximum size of 158 cm.
- First Class: 3 bags, each with a weight limit of 32 kg and size up to 158 cm.

Lufthansa Check-In Times and Deadlines
Knowing the right Lufthansa check-in time is important to avoid stress at the airport and ensure a smooth boarding process. Whether you’re checking in online or at the airport.
Online Check-In Time
Lufthansa check-in time online starts 23 hours before departure. You can check in through the Lufthansa website or mobile app. During this process you can:
- Choose or change your seat
- Enter travel document details
- Download your digital boarding pass
Early online check-in helps save time at the airport especially if you are only traveling with carry-on luggage.
Airport Check-In Time
Airport check-in usually opens 2 to 3 hours before departure depending on your destination and class of service. For most international flights check-in closes 60 minutes before takeoff.
For smoother boarding it’s recommended to arrive at the airport early—especially during busy travel periods.
Newark Business Class Check-In Example
At some airports like Newark (EWR) Lufthansa offers dedicated check-in areas for premium passengers. The Lufthansa Newark check-in business counter allows Business Class passengers to check in faster with shorter lines and priority service.
At Newark:
- Business Class check-in opens around 3 hours before flight time
- Dedicated counters help speed up the check-in and baggage drop process
To avoid delays or missed flights always confirm the exact Lufthansa check-in time for your route and class on the official Lufthansa website or app. Deadlines may vary by airport, especially for long-haul or codeshare flights.

Step-by-Step: How to Check In Online
Here’s how to complete your Lufthansa online web check-in in just a few steps:
- Go to the Lufthansa website (www.lufthansa.com) or open the Lufthansa app.
- Click on Check-In at the top menu.
- Enter your booking code or ticket number and last name.
- Select your flight and confirm passenger details.
- Choose your seat and add any extras if needed.
- Download or receive your mobile boarding pass via email or SMS.
You can also check in Lufthansa online using the mobile app, which lets you store your boarding pass in your phone’s wallet or app for easy access.
